Being Aware of Sustainable Agriculture
The secret to guaranteeing food security and reducing environmental degradation is sustainable farming. In India, a large percentage of the workforce is employed in agriculture, hence implementing sustainable methods is essential for the country's future generations. Traditional farming methods are being replaced by more sustainable ones that preserve crop productivity, preserve resources, and lessen farming's carbon imprint. A range of strategies are included in sustainable farming practices with the goal of lowering reliance on chemical inputs and increasing resource efficiency. Preserving biodiversity is one of the guiding principles. Besides improving soil health, planting a diversity of crops also promotes natural pest control and lowers the likelihood of disease outbreaks. Crop rotation is a straightforward but efficient method that helps to minimise the need for synthetic fertilisers by ensuring that the soil is refreshed with various nutrients. Additionally, including livestock into farming systems improves productivity and integrates nutrient cycles.
India's agricultural landscape might be revolutionised by sustainable farming practices that prioritise long-term soil fertility and water conservation. With the escalation of environmental issues like water scarcity and climate change, these techniques are becoming increasingly important. Additionally, the move towards Farmers gain from the transition to sustainable agriculture, but customers also gain since more and more people are demanding organic and environmentally friendly produce.
Water-Sparing Methods One of the most important issues facing Indian agriculture is water scarcity. In many farming locations, the depletion of groundwater levels is the result of excessive use of water resources and ineffective irrigation techniques. Using water-saving measures is essential to guaranteeing agricultural productivity in the long run.
Drip irrigation is one of the best water-saving techniques available. By delivering water straight to plant roots, this technology reduces water waste from evaporation and runoff. In areas like Maharashtra and Rajasthan where water is scarce, drip irrigation has been extensively advocated. Farmers can improve crop yields and drastically cut water consumption by employing this strategy.
Another useful method for conserving water is rainwater gathering. Farmers can make use of rainwater during dry intervals by gathering and storing it, which is particularly advantageous in areas with unpredictable rainfall patterns. Rainwater harvesting facilities, including tanks and check dams, can be installed to assist retain soil moisture and supply crops with water when they need it most.
Farmers can also use mulching to keep the moisture in the soil. Soil covered with organic content, such compost or crop wastes, retains moisture better and requires less frequent irrigation. In addition to aiding in weed control and soil temperature regulation, this method promotes crop growth.
In addition to increasing water availability, effective water management in agriculture supports the long-term viability of farming ecosystems. By combining ancient wisdom with contemporary irrigation methods, Indian farmers would be able to increase output and fight water scarcity.
Management of Soil Health Sustainably farmed land requires soil health maintenance. Crop productivity in India has been negatively impacted by soil deterioration brought on by excessive use of chemical fertilisers and pesticides, as well as by bad agricultural methods. Prioritising methods that enhance soil health is essential for farmers who want to continue farming in a sustainable manner.
The application of organic fertilisers is one of the most crucial techniques for managing soil health. One organic method of recycling organic waste into nutrient-rich soil additions is through composting. Farmyard manure, crop leftovers, and kitchen trash can all be used by farmers to make compost, which increases the microbial activity and nutrient content of the soil. Earthworms are used in the vermicomposting process, which is an efficient method of enhancing soil fertility and structure.
Crop rotation is an easy way to keep soil healthy, yet it works incredibly well. Farmers can lessen soil erosion, increase nutrient availability, and disrupt the cycle of pests and illnesses by rotating various crops in the same field over the course of several seasons. Legumes, like lentils or chickpeas, can be used in place of cereals like wheat or rice, for example, because they fix nitrogen in the soil and lessen the need for artificial fertilisers.
A method that is becoming more and more common is cover cropping. By sowing cover crops in the off-season, such rye or clover, you can decrease nutrient loss, stop soil erosion, and improve the amount of organic matter in your soil. Additionally, cover crops encourage water retention and weed suppression, enhancing the general health of the farming ecosystem.
Using Organic Farming Methods In India, organic farming has gained popularity as a viable method due to the growing desire for healthy produce free of chemicals. Organic farming discourages the use of synthetic chemicals and genetically modified organisms (GMOs) and promotes the use of natural inputs like organic fertilisers.
Biopesticide use is one of the main tenets of organic farming. An example of an organic insecticide that works well to control pests without endangering beneficial insects is neem oil, which is made from the neem tree. Compost tea, a liquid fertiliser created by steeping compost in water, is another method. This gives crops naturally occurring nutrients, boosting soil fertility and plant health.
The comprehensive method known as integrated pest management (IPM) blends mechanical, cultural, and biological techniques to keep pests under control. This technique works by introducing beneficial insects or microbes to manage diseases and pests. By reducing the use of chemical pesticides, IPM protects the ecosystem of the farm.
Moreover, Indian farmers are finding it easier to obtain organic certification. Farmers that adopt organic practices can become certified, enabling them to sell their produce at premium prices both domestically and abroad, as the advantages of organic produce become more widely known. Additionally, the Indian government has launched programs like the Paramparagat Krishi Vikas Yojana (PKVY) to encourage organic agricultural methods and offer assistance to farmers switching to organic systems.
Technology and Renewable Energy in Agriculture The agricultural sector in India has undergone a change with the integration of renewable energy sources like solar and wind power. For example, the usage of solar-powered water pumps is growing in rural regions to lessen reliance on diesel irrigation pumps and grid electricity.
In addition, farmers are adopting digital platforms and smartphone apps to get up-to-date information on market pricing, soil conditions, and weather forecasts. With the use of these technology, farmers are better able to plan ahead, use resources more efficiently, and increase output.
